Darren Cahill set to coach World No.1 Jannik Sinner through 2026 as the duo extend partnership
Following his incredible run to the title at the 2025 Wimbledon Championships, Italian tennis superstar Jannik Sinner has agreed to new terms with coach Darren Cahill, ensuring the duo will be working together till the end of 2026. Darren Cahill arrived alongside Jannik Sinner in June 2022, and he will finally stay until the end of the 2026 season. While the Australian coach had to stop his collaboration with the world leader at the end of this season in order to rest, the Italian got that he stayed a little longer at his side. Darren Cahill, who is after leaving Jannik Sinner's team at the end of the season, will extend his contract with a year, according to the Sera Corriere. The Australian trainer legend, who will continue to work with Simone Vagnozzi, would then make fewer moves.
